The main contribution of this paper is a new efficient and low-cost condition monitoring system based on radiometric sensors. The thermal patterns of the main photovoltaic faults (hot spot, fault cell, open circuit, bypass diode, and polarization) are studied in real photovoltaic panels.
Considering that the change of the visual image does not necessarily mean the presence of a fault in a PV panel, the thermal image of the PV panel is more favoured in the practice of PV panel condition monitoring (Kandeal et al., 2021a).
Thermography is the imaging method that can make more than PV-module defects visible. Many deficiencies/deviations from normal operation can be detected using IR-imaging, namely: PV module faults [ 27, 28 ], all kinds of thermal anomalies and temperature gradients.

PV modules commonly consist of several layers, including fully transparent glass covers for protection, highly transparent EVA films, and the core PV cell.
Energy 4 042010 DOI 10.1088/2516-1083/ac890b Thermography is a frequently used and appreciated method to detect underperforming Photovoltaic modules in solar power stations.
